Data Processing Notes:
----------------------
Conductivity and Fluorescence data are nominal and unedited except that some
records were removed in editing temperature and salinity.
NOTE: While the CTD fluorescence data are expressed in concentration units, they
do not always compare well to extracted chlorophyll samples, particularly for
casts far from shore.
The only data available for event #66 came from the soak period so they have not
been processed.
There was no calibration sampling during this cruise. Recalibration of dissolved
oxygen data was based on an intercomparison with an SBE911 on one cast during a
previous cruise. This is considered a rough estimate.
Salinity was not recalibrated; rough comparisons during 2 previous cruises suggest
it is within +/-0.005psu.
For details on the processing see document: 2018-090_Processing_Report.doc.
